Executive Summary
We assess that the use of vehicle-ramming attacks as a terrorist tactic is a growing international security threat. The wide availability of vehicles and the ease of planning and executing such attacks pose a major challenge for law enforcement and intelligence agencies to detect and prevent them. Both the Islamic State (IS) and Al-Qaeda have encouraged their followers to execute such attacks due to their destructive capabilities. [source, source]
The use of vehicles as a terrorist weapon is not new and has been observed since the 1960s-70s, however, the last decade has seen a sharp rise in their occurrence. We do not expect a divergence from this trend. [source, source]
